平方在c语言里编程输入什么
-
在C语言中,平方可以通过以下代码实现:
#include <stdio.h> int main() { int number, square; printf("请输入一个整数:"); scanf("%d", &number); square = number * number; printf("%d的平方是%d\n", number, square); return 0; }首先,我们需要定义两个变量:
number和square。number用来存储用户输入的整数,square用来存储计算得到的平方值。然后,我们使用
printf函数向用户提示输入一个整数,并使用scanf函数接收用户的输入并将其存储在number变量中。接下来,我们通过将
number乘以自身的方式计算平方,并将结果存储在square变量中。最后,使用
printf函数输出计算得到的平方值。以上就是使用C语言编程实现平方的方法。通过这段代码,用户可以输入一个整数,然后程序会计算并输出该整数的平方值。
1年前 -
在C语言中,要计算一个数的平方,可以使用乘法运算符
*进行计算。具体的编程输入取决于你想要实现的功能和程序的具体要求。以下是几种常见的计算平方的方法:
- 使用变量存储输入的数值,然后使用乘法运算符计算平方:
#include <stdio.h> int main() { int num; printf("请输入一个整数:"); scanf("%d", &num); int square = num * num; printf("%d的平方是%d\n", num, square); return 0; }- 使用函数来计算平方,将输入的数作为参数传递给函数,函数返回平方的结果:
#include <stdio.h> int square(int num) { return num * num; } int main() { int num; printf("请输入一个整数:"); scanf("%d", &num); int result = square(num); printf("%d的平方是%d\n", num, result); return 0; }- 使用宏定义来计算平方,通过宏定义可以直接在代码中使用
NUM_SQUARE来计算平方:
#include <stdio.h> #define NUM_SQUARE(x) ((x) * (x)) int main() { int num; printf("请输入一个整数:"); scanf("%d", &num); int result = NUM_SQUARE(num); printf("%d的平方是%d\n", num, result); return 0; }- 使用指针来计算平方,通过指针操作可以直接修改变量的值:
#include <stdio.h> void square(int* num) { *num = (*num) * (*num); } int main() { int num; printf("请输入一个整数:"); scanf("%d", &num); square(&num); printf("%d的平方是%d\n", num, num); return 0; }- 使用数学库函数
pow()来计算平方,pow()函数可以计算任意数的幂:
#include <stdio.h> #include <math.h> int main() { double num; printf("请输入一个实数:"); scanf("%lf", &num); double square = pow(num, 2); printf("%lf的平方是%lf\n", num, square); return 0; }以上是几种常见的计算平方的方法,具体选择哪种方法取决于你的需求和编程环境。请根据自己的实际情况选择合适的方法来实现。
1年前 -
要在C语言中计算一个数的平方,可以通过以下步骤进行编程:
-
引入头文件:在C语言中,需要引入
stdio.h头文件来使用标准输入输出函数。可以使用#include <stdio.h>语句将头文件引入到程序中。 -
定义变量:在程序中,需要定义一个变量来存储输入的数值和计算结果。可以使用
int或float类型的变量来存储整数或浮点数。 -
获取用户输入:使用
scanf函数来从用户处获取输入的数值。可以使用scanf("%d", &num)语句来获取整数输入,其中%d表示整数的格式,&num表示将输入的值存储到num变量中。 -
计算平方:使用一个算术运算符
*来计算输入数值的平方。可以使用result = num * num语句来计算平方,并将结果存储在result变量中。 -
显示结果:使用
printf函数来将计算结果输出到屏幕上。可以使用printf("平方值为:%d\n", result)语句来输出计算结果,其中%d表示整数的格式,result表示要输出的变量。
下面是一个完整的示例代码:
#include <stdio.h> int main() { int num, result; printf("请输入一个整数:"); scanf("%d", &num); result = num * num; printf("平方值为:%d\n", result); return 0; }在运行程序时,会提示用户输入一个整数,然后计算该整数的平方并将结果输出到屏幕上。
注意:在使用
scanf函数获取用户输入时,要确保输入的值与变量的类型匹配,否则可能会导致错误或意外的结果。在使用printf函数输出结果时,要根据变量的类型使用正确的格式符,否则可能会导致输出错误的结果。1年前 -